Keyword Intent Analysis: A Guide for Business Loan Providers
Understanding your borrower's goal when searching for financing information is absolutely important for effectiveness in the financial industry. Keyword intent analysis goes past keyword targeting and examines into why someone is truly desiring . Are they just exploring possibilities , evaluating different institutions, or prepared to apply for a loan ? A thorough analysis should evaluate several kinds of intent:
- Informational: Seeking basic data about credit .
- Navigational: Attempting to find a certain lender's platform .
- Transactional: Intending to receive a funding .
